天台上的Python编程:从入门到实践的轻松学习指南363
大家好!我是你们的Python编程导师,今天我们来聊聊“天台Python编程课”。或许你想象中,这是一个在凉爽的天台,微风习习,一边喝着咖啡,一边轻松学习Python编程的浪漫场景。虽然实际情况可能没有那么诗情画意,但我们依然可以通过这篇指南,将学习Python的过程变得轻松愉快,就像在舒适的天台一样。
Python作为一门易于学习且功能强大的编程语言,近年来备受青睐。它简洁的语法,丰富的库和框架,以及庞大的社区支持,使得无论是初学者还是经验丰富的程序员,都能从中受益匪浅。本篇文章将从入门到实践,带你逐步掌握Python编程的核心知识。
一、Python的安装与环境配置
学习任何编程语言的第一步都是安装其运行环境。Python的安装非常简单,你只需要访问Python官方网站 (),下载适合你操作系统的版本,然后按照安装向导进行安装即可。安装完成后,建议你配置环境变量,以便在命令行或终端中直接运行Python程序。不同的操作系统配置方法略有不同,你可以通过搜索引擎查找相关的教程。
对于初学者,推荐使用一个集成开发环境 (IDE),例如PyCharm (专业版功能更强大,社区版免费且轻量级),VS Code (功能强大,可通过插件扩展功能),或者Thonny (专为初学者设计的简单易用的IDE)。这些IDE都提供代码高亮、自动补全、调试等功能,可以显著提高编程效率。
二、Python基础语法
Python的语法简洁易懂,这正是它广受欢迎的原因之一。学习Python,你需要掌握以下基本语法元素:
变量和数据类型: Python是动态类型的语言,你不需要显式声明变量的类型。常见的Python数据类型包括整数、浮点数、字符串、布尔值等。
运算符: Python支持各种运算符,包括算术运算符、比较运算符、逻辑运算符等。
控制流语句: if-else语句、for循环和while循环是控制程序执行流程的关键。
函数: 函数是组织代码的有效方式,可以提高代码的可重用性和可读性。
数据结构: 列表 (list)、元组 (tuple)、字典 (dictionary) 和集合 (set) 是Python中常用的数据结构,理解它们的使用方法至关重要。
三、Python常用库和模块
Python拥有丰富的库和模块,可以帮助你轻松完成各种任务。以下是一些常用的库:
NumPy: 用于科学计算,提供了强大的数组操作功能。
Pandas: 用于数据分析,提供了方便的数据结构和数据处理工具。
Matplotlib: 用于数据可视化,可以创建各种类型的图表。
Requests: 用于网络请求,可以方便地访问网页数据。
Beautiful Soup: 用于网页解析,可以从网页中提取所需的信息。
学习这些库,你需要掌握它们的API文档,并通过实践来加深理解。
四、实践项目
学习编程最好的方式是实践。你可以尝试完成一些小项目,例如:
简单的计算器: 编写一个程序,实现加、减、乘、除等基本运算。
简单的文本处理程序: 编写一个程序,读取文本文件,统计单词个数,或者替换某些字符。
简单的网络爬虫: 编写一个程序,从网页上抓取数据。
简单的游戏: 例如,编写一个猜数字游戏或者井字棋游戏。
通过完成这些项目,你可以巩固所学的知识,并提升你的编程能力。记住,实践出真知!
五、持续学习
学习编程是一个持续的过程,你需要不断学习新的知识和技术。你可以通过阅读书籍、观看视频教程、参加在线课程等方式来提升自己的编程水平。Python社区非常活跃,你可以在网上找到大量的学习资源。
希望这篇“天台Python编程课”能够帮助你轻松入门Python编程。记住,学习编程需要耐心和毅力,只要你坚持下去,就一定能够掌握这门强大的技能! 祝你学习愉快!
2025-05-16

化妆视频脚本语言:从专业术语到创作技巧全解析
https://jb123.cn/jiaobenyuyan/54571.html

DW使用什么脚本语言?揭秘Dreamweaver背后的代码力量
https://jb123.cn/jiaobenyuyan/54570.html

Python游戏编程入门指南:从零基础到小游戏制作
https://jb123.cn/python/54569.html

Python编程原理深度解析:从解释器到内存管理
https://jb123.cn/python/54568.html

Perl中ASCII码表的应用与详解
https://jb123.cn/perl/54567.html
热门文章

Python 编程解密:从谜团到清晰
https://jb123.cn/python/24279.html

Python编程深圳:初学者入门指南
https://jb123.cn/python/24225.html

Python 编程终端:让开发者畅所欲为的指令中心
https://jb123.cn/python/22225.html

Python 编程专业指南:踏上编程之路的全面指南
https://jb123.cn/python/20671.html

Python 面向对象编程学习宝典,PDF 免费下载
https://jb123.cn/python/3929.html